Community Q&A | Episode 17

In episode 17 of the AI Security Ops Podcast, hosts Joff Thyer, Derek Banks, Brian Fehrman and Bronwen Aker answer viewer-submitted questions about system prompts, prompt injection risks, AI hallucinations, deep fakes, and when (and when not) to use AI in cybersecurity. 

They'll discuss the difference between system and user prompts, how temperature settings impact LLM outputs, and the biggest mistakes companies make when deploying AI models. 

They'll also explain how to reduce hallucinations, and approach AI responsibly in security workflows. Derek explains his method for detecting audio deep fakes.
